I went to the verizon store in Malone NY and they didn't have the lapdock 100 but I was able to try my Atrix HD in a Bionic Lapdock.

Simply put, the lapdock is a 12 inches HDMI monitor with a USB hub speading the AHD micro USB port to 2 full sized usb ports, the keyboard and the trackpad.

So it turn your phone into a large screen netbook Under android ICS... with 4g lte connectivity.

It was just fine without the heavy webtop app. Specialy for 49$

The bionic lapdock was still at 129$

By the way, all the lapdock, exception made for the 500 model, are dumb device. Any smartphone or device with hdmi out and usb out can be connected to the motorola lapdock. ( including the mk802 android stick or the samsung galaxy series)

Got the lapdock for the 4g. The keyboard is just amazing, screen is perfect, I just use the overscan setting on the atrix hd to match the screen resolution and fill it completely. I had to flip the lapdock connectors as Stated in various post on lapdock vs razr. Easy job, perfect results. I use the chrome browser and it just work as it should be.

Very well invested 50 Bucks

Edit: only the lapdock for the atrix 4g need to have the connectors flipped. The bionic, the lapdock 100 and the lapdock 500 just fit out of the box.

no wifi/3G is still OK and the screen just rotate to the correct orientation.

do you have a setting for settings>input>pointer speed ?

I use a wireless mouse



when connected, you can switch in settings>sound> from hdmi audio to phone speakers, the lapdock speakers are pretty(very) horrible...

The lapdock speakers are OK, you can pump up the volume on the cell phone AND you can pump up the volume on the lapdock (it is really just an HDMI monitor with separate volume and brightness settings)
